site stats

Create primary key in snowflake

WebInstead of creating or dropping an index in Snowflake, you can use clustering keys to accomplish query performance. This tutorial will show you how to define a clustering key … WebMay 3, 2024 · - package: Snowflake-Labs/dbt_constraints version: 0.3.0 Run dbt deps. Optionally add primary_key, unique_key, or foreign_key tests to your model like the following examples. - name:...

How to Create an Index in Snowflake - PopSQL

WebMulti-column constraints (e.g. compound unique or primary keys) can only be defined out-of-line. When defining foreign keys, either inline or out-of-line, column name(s) for the referenced table do not need to be specified if the signature (i.e. name and data type) of … WebDec 7, 2024 · Conclusion. Although the PRIMARY KEY, UNIQUE, and FOREIGN KEY constraints are provided in Snowflake, they are not enforced. They are mainly used for … tabs all secret units good https://thesimplenecklace.com

dbt Constraints: Automatic Primary Keys, Unique Keys, and

WebMay 25, 2024 · You can add primary key constraint to a column but cannot alter an existing one. Drop and recreate the primary key. Here's an example: ALTER TABLE … WebSep 15, 2024 · CREATE TABLE TEST_TABLE_TEMP LIKE TEST_TABLE; ALTER TABLE TEST_TABLE_TEMP ADD COLUMN primary_key int IDENTITY (1,1); INSERT INTO TEST_TABLE_TEMP (col1,col2,...) SELECT col1,col2,... FROM TEST_TABLE; If you want to add your primary column in other place than last you need to create DDL for your table. WebGenerated SQL and PL/SQL scripts to install create and drop database objects, including tables, views, primary keys, indexes, constraints, packages, sequences, grants and synonyms. tabs all secret units 2021

Add constraints and descriptions to table - dbt Community Forum

Category:How to use the Snowflake Primary Key Constraint Estuary

Tags:Create primary key in snowflake

Create primary key in snowflake

How to Create an Index in Snowflake - PopSQL

WebSep 23, 2024 · Photo by Alp Duran on Unsplash *** Update June 2024: Snowflake has just announced Unistore which means Snowflake has a new Hybrid Table Type that allows … WebApr 6, 2024 · Default value is 1, if you wish to inherit the parent schema setting then pass in the schema attribute to this argument. - `primary_key` (Block List, Max: 1, Deprecated) …

Create primary key in snowflake

Did you know?

WebThe destination queries Snowflake for the primary key columns for each table that it writes to. Use this option only when primary key columns are defined in the Snowflake tables. ... uses the primary key information in the Primary Key Location property to create primary key columns. To allow for existing records that do not include the new ... WebApr 5, 2024 · The primary keys and foreign keys enable members of your project team to orient themselves to the schema design and familiarize themselves with how the tables …

WebIf the primary key is composed of multiple columns, then the number in the key_sequence column indicates the order of those columns in the primary key. For example, if the … WebFeb 24, 2024 · To ensure description appear, add persist_docs = {"relation": true, 'columns': true} to the config block. Or have a read of the documentation. Can’t help with the Snowflake primary key question, I’m not familiar with Snowflake. It works very well. Many thanks for your assistance.

WebIf the primary key is composed of multiple columns, then the number in the key_sequence column indicates the order of those columns in the primary key. For example, if the primary key is defined as CONSTRAINT pkey1 PRIMARY KEY (column_x, column_y), then the key_sequence number for column_x is 1 and the key_sequence number for column_y is 2. WebMay 26, 2024 · Drop and recreate the primary key. Here's an example: ALTER TABLE "tablename" DROP CONSTRAINT "pk_name"; ALTER TABLE "tablename" ADD CONSTRAINT "pk_name" PRIMARY KEY (col1,col2); Share Follow edited Jan 13 at 11:53 Pouya Ataei 1,891 2 19 29 answered Jun 11, 2024 at 17:21 Rob D 111 1 4 Add a …

WebDec 23, 2024 · The optimizer uses the primary key to create an optimal execution plan. A table can have multiple unique keys and foreign keys, but only one primary key. Snowflake Primary Key Constraint Syntax. …

WebCREATE TABLE command in Snowflake - Syntax and Examples. Important. Using OR REPLACE is the equivalent of using on the existing table and then creating a new table with the same name; however, the dropped table is not permanently removed from the system. Instead, it is retained in Time Travel. This is important to note because dropped tables in … tabs all secrets 2021WebAs you've probably seen, Snowflake will take Primary Key statements and Foreign key statements and will store them in its information schema internally. These constraints, however, are treated as documentation only and are not enforced by Snowflake at all. tabs all secret units locations 2021WebMay 3, 2024 · In addition, although Snowflake doesn’t enforce most constraints, the query optimizer can consider primary key, unique key, and foreign key constraints during … tabs allows users to freeze rows/columnsWebHASH function in Snowflake - Syntax and Examples. 👨‍💼 Account ... means to create a single hashed value based on all columns in the row. Do not use HASH() to create unique keys. HASH() has a finite resolution of 64 bits, and is guaranteed to return non-unique values if more than 2^64 values are entered, e.g. for a table with more than 2 ... tabs alpha versionWebJul 26, 2024 · Snowflake supports user sequences for the four integer types : byteint, smallint, integer, and bigint. For example, you can use sequences in unique columns, primary key columns, etc. You can even create a sequence with an initial value, an increment value. The Snowflake sequences will throw an error when it reaches the … tabs alpha testing freeWebNov 22, 2024 · In Snowflake, you can set the default value for a column, which is typically used to set an autoincrement or identity as the default value, so that each time a new row is inserted a unique id for that row is generated and stored and can be used as a primary key. You can specify the default value for a column using create table or alter table. tabs all secretsWebAug 25, 2024 · A tag is a schema-level object which can hold any arbitrary string value in Key-Value format. You can create a tag on any database object, and the same tag can be assigned to multiple objects ... tabs all secret units locations legacy update